Krita 5.1 Sürüm Notları
5.0’dan sonraki ilk büyük sürüm olan Krita 5.1, bir sürü küçük iyileştirme ve teknik cilayla birlikte geliyor. Bu sürümde genel kullanılabilirlik güncellemeleri, gelişmiş dosya biçimi kullanımı ve seçme ve doldurma araçlarında pek çok değişiklik yer alıyor.
Aşağıdaki özellik gösterimlerinin çoğu için David Revoy’a ve en sevdiği yeni özellikleri bir videoda derlediği için Wojtryb’e çok teşekkür ederiz:
Ücretsiz ve açık kaynaklı bir proje olarak Krita’nın yardımınıza ihtiyacı var! Lütfen kalkınma fonuna üye olarak projeyi desteklemeyi düşünün. Katkılarınızla, profesyonel geliştiricilerden oluşan çekirdek bir ekibin Krita üzerinde çalışmasını sağlayabiliriz.
Katmanlar
- Krita 5.1’deki katman işlemedeki en büyük değişiklik, Santhosh Anguluri’nin Google Summer of Code 2021 projesidir: Çoklu katmanlara yönelik işlemler (MR 888). Bu, aynı anda birden fazla katman üzerinde seçim yaparken kopyalama, kesme, yapıştırma ve silme işlemlerine olanak tanır.
- Bunun ötesinde, katman panelinde yapılan az sayıda kullanıcı arayüzü düzenlemesi var: Artık katmanların bir gruptayken ne kadar güçlü girintili olacağını denetleyebilirsiniz. Ayrıca sağ tık kullanılamadığında bağlam menüsünü gösteren bir düğme eklendi ve son olarak dosya katmanları artık dosyalarının bulunamadığını rapor ediyor (MR 1443, MR 1213, MR 1419).
- Artık seçim maskelerini harmanlama kipleriyle boyayabilirsiniz (MR 1437).
Dosya Biçimleri
- WebP desteği (MR 891 MR 1268). Zaten temel WebP desteğimiz vardı; ancak bu, akla gelebilecek her türlü geçişle WebP Codec kullanımıyla tam destek sağlıyor.
- Photoshop katmanlı TIFF desteği (MR 944). Adobe, TIFF belirtiminin sorumlusu olmasına rağmen, Photoshop’un katmanları bir TIFF dosyasına kaydetmenin spesifikasyonlarla uyumlu olmayan benzersiz bir yöntemi vardır: Bütün bir PSD belgesini üst verilere yerleştirmek. Artık bu tür dosyalardan veri yüklemeyi destekliyoruz. Üstelik TIFF için dışa aktarma iletişim kutusu yeniden düzenlendi ve artık üst verileri tiff’e yükleyip kaydediyoruz (MR 1015).
- OpenExr 2.3 ve 3+ desteği (MR 1049). Yapı sistemimizdeki bir hatadan dolayı Krita OpenExr 2.3 ve üzeri sürümleri göremiyordu; bu düzeltildi.
- Panodan görsel verisinin alımı (MR 1296, MR 1431). Programlar arasında veri kopyaladığınızda bu veriler sistem panosuna konulur. Bazen bu görsellerle yapıldığında programlar birkaç farklı seçenek ekler. Bu seçeneklerden hangisini kullanmak istediğinizi seçmenize olanak tanıyan kullanıcı arayüzünü geliştirdik.
- PSD dolgu katmanları ve renk etiketleri(MR 1309). Bu, katman renk etiketlerinin PSD’ye yüklenmesine ve kaydedilmesine, ayrıca gradyan, desen ve renk dolgu katmanlarının yüklenmesine ve kaydedilmesine olanak tanır. Bu, Krita’nın içindeki ASL ayrıştırıcısını genişletir, bu da katman biçemlerinin daha iyi renk ve desen aktarımına sahip olduğu anlamına gelir. Çoğu PSD, bu dolgu katmanlarını henüz uygulanmayan vektör maskeleriyle birlikte kullanır.
- JPEG-XL desteği (MR 1363). Avif’in son sürümünün uygulanmasına ek olarak JPEG-XL, JPEG görsel dosyası biçiminin en yeni güncellemesidir ve geniş renk gamlarını ve HDR’yi web’e getirmek için tasarlanmış yeni dosya biçimlerinden biridir. HDR renk uzaylarının JPEG-XL’e kaydedilmesini ve yüklenmesini henüz etkinleştirmedik; ancak elimizdeki şey canlandırmaları kaydedip yüklemek, böylece JPEG-XL’i canlandırmaların dışa aktarılmasına izin vermek için FFMPEG gerektirmeyen ilk dosya biçimi haline getiriyoruz.
- ASE ve ACB renk paleti desteği (Commit 6c7ed052). İlki Adobe uygulamaları arasında kullanılır, ikincisi ise Photoshop’un spot renk listesini tanımlamak için kullandığı biçimdir. Özellikle Pantone değerlerinin oldukça sık güncellendiği görüldüğünden, insanları ikincisine karşı biraz dikkatli olmaya çağırıyoruz. Hangi spot renklerini kullanmak istediğinizi yazıcınızla görüşün.
Teknik Konular
Bu seferki en büyük değişikliklerden bazıları tamamen teknik nitelikteydi.
- OCIO sistemi için OpenGl ES’yi düzelt (MR 1262), bu, OCIO’nun artık Android’de çalıştığı anlamına gelir. Ayrıca, VFX Platform CY2021 için yeni GPU sistemini kullanıyoruz (Commit 3d24ed13).
- Windows için Angle’ın daha yeni bir sürümünü yap (MR 1373, MR 1353). Bizim kullandığımız biraz eskiydi ve bu yenisinin birçok düzeltmesi var. Angle, OpenGL’yi Windows’ta kullanmamıza izin veren en güvenilir yol oldu.
- YCbCr profilleri eklendi (MR 1330). Açık sürümleri olmadığından YCbCr profillerini hiçbir zaman Krita ile vermedik. Bu, özellikle dosya sınamaları olmak üzere bazı özelliklerin sınanmasını oldukça zorlaştırdı. Bu yüzden bazı YCbCr profillerini oluşturduk ve bunları öntanımlı profiller olarak ekledik.
- Windows üzerinde llvm-mingw araç zinciri desteği eklendi (MR 1372).
- RISC-V ile derlemeye izin ver (MR 1416). Bizden kimsede RISC-V makine henüz yok, dolayısıyla bu daha çok meraklılar için.
- Krita’yı VC’den XSIMD’ye aktardık (MR 1404). Bu kitaplıkları, ‘vektör yönergeleri’ olarak adlandırılan, bilgisayarı kullanmanın, özellikle renkleri harmanlama ve karıştırma gibi tekrarlayan matematik işlemleri için kullanırız. VC’nin gelişimi durdu, dolayısıyla XSIMD’ye geçiş artık gelecek hakkında daha az endişelenmemize olanak sağlıyor. Güzel bir yan etki, renkli ve hafif fırça uçlarının iyi bir hız artışı sağlamasının yanı sıra ARM aygıtlarda (yani tabletler ve cep telefonları) hız artışı sağlamasıdır.
- Krita’yı önden derlenmiş üstbilgilerle yapma desteği eklendi (MR 1471). Bu, derleme zamanını azalttığından geliştiricilerin işine yarar.
- Windows’ta AppData dizininin yeri hakkında daha ayrıntılı bilgi ver (MR 1304). Eğer Microsoft Store sürümü kullanılıyorsa AppData dizininin yeri farklı olabileceğinden insanlara ayrıntılı bilgi vermek istedik.
Kullanılabilirlik
- Belirli renk seçicisi bir renk önizlemesi ve RGB içn HSV seçeneğiyle genişletildi. (MR 916, MR 1434).
- Dokunma hareketleri (kaydırmak, yakınlaştırmak, döndürmek) artık yapılandırılabilir; hangi eylemin neyi yapacağını seçebilirsiniz (MR 1341).
- Yakınlaştırmanın hemen yanında 'piksellerin yönünü kullan’ gibi bir şey söyleyen çok belirsiz bir düğmemiz vardı. Bu gizemli düğmenin gerçekte yaptığı şey, tuval yakınlaştırmasını, pikselleri piksel boyutunda göstermek ve tuvali fiziksel boyutunda göstermek arasında değiştirmekti. İkincisi, eğer Krita kullanılabilir bilgiye sahipse Krita’daki bir inçin monitörünüzdeki gerçek bir inç olduğu anlamına gelir; bu baskı için kullanışlıdır, ilki ise oyun grafikleri gibi yalnızca sayısal işler için daha kullanışlıdır. Bu düğme bunu daha net bir şekilde iletmek için yenilendi (MR 1220).
- Açılır palet için daha çok yapılandırma seçeneği (MR 922).
- İkili renk seçicisi kısayolu (MR 1100)
- Eksik süzgeç kısayolları (MR 1109)
- Önceden tanımlı yakınlaştırma düzeylerini seçerek sarmadan ‘pürüzsüz yakınlaştırmaya’ geçiş yapma olanağı eklendi (MR 1138).
- Son kullanılan dosyalar menüsü yeniden düzenlendi (MR 1258, MR 1283, MR 1295, MR 1297, MR 1307).
- Sağdan sola yerleşim iyileştirmeleri (MR 1267)
- Çoğu iletişim kutuları için düzeltmeler (MR 1317, MR 1328, MR 1331)
- İnce ayar süzgeçlerine HSV sürgüleri. (MR 1438).
- Pivot’u yalnızca Seçenek düğmesine basıldığında dönüşüm sınırıyla sınırla (MR 1440).
- Sayısal Renk Karıştırıcısı için sıfırlama düğmesi ve durum kaydetme (MR 1361).
- Yeni sığdırmak üzere yakınlaştır (kenar boşluklu) seçeneği (MR 1344).
Dolgu ve Seçim Araçları
Deif Lou, son 6 ayını dolgu ve bitişik seçim araçlarının işlevselliğini büyük ölçüde geliştirmek için harcadı.
Bu araçların seçenekleri artık daha kapsamlı (MR 1360, MR 1453), yeni değişken yumuşaklık sürgülerindan dolayı gerekli bir özellikti (MR 1174); ek olarak FXAA algoritması tabanlı kapsamlı kenar yumuşatma (MR 1350).
Artık bir dolgu uygulamanın üç farklı yolu var. Birincisi, imleci doldurmak istediğiniz bölgelerin üzerinde sürüklemenize izin veren Sürekli Dolgu (MR 1160).
İkincisi ise, doldurmak istediğiniz her şeyin üzerine bir dikdörtgen veya başka bir şeklin sürüklenmesine olanak tanıyan ve Krita’nın hangi bölümlerin dolduracağını kendiliğinden belirleyen tümüyle yeni Kapsa ve Doldur aracı (MR 1415).
Sonuncusu, sürükle ve bırak renk örneği işlevinde büyük iyileştirmelerden oluşuyor (MR 1135). Artık renk örneklerini tuvalin bir bölümüne bırakabilirsiniz ve Krita, bırakılan rengin bölümü nasıl dolduracağını belirlemek için geçerli doldurma aracı seçeneklerini kullanacaktır.
Fırçalar
- En büyük fırça hızını yapılandırmak için arayüz seçeneği (MR 996).
- Akış, solma ve dağılım için kısayol ayarı eklendi (MR 1037).
- Asistana tutunan silgileri isteğe bağlı hale getir (MR 1199).
- Püskürtme motoruna daha fazla parçacık dağılımı ekle (MR 1377).
- Keskinlik seçeneklerini ana hatlarıyla hizalama davranışını isteğe bağlı yap (MR 1405). Piksel sanatını nasıl yaptığınıza bağlı olarak bunu isteyebilir veya istemeyebilirsiniz.
- Silgiler için ayrı imleç ayarlarına izin ver (MR 1426).
- Fırça ana hattını değiştirmek için kısayol ayarı ekle (MR 1430).
- Eskiz Fırçası İşletkesinde artık yumuşatma var (MR 1425).
Diğer
- Kayıtçı panel dışa aktarımında son kareyi tutma seçeneği (MR 1087).
- Kayıtçı dışa aktarımında sonucu en başta gösterme seçeneği (MR 1293).
- Perspektif elips yardımcı aracı eklendir (MR 1343). Srirupa Datta’nın 2022 KDE Kod Sezonu projesi, perspektif elips aracı asistanı, perspektifte daireler çizmeye yardımcı oluyor.
- Cetvel yardımcıları için alt bölmeler (MR 1298).
- Ekran tonu üreteci için iyileştirmeler (MR 1010), üretecin sonuç ürünü artık daha tutarlı.
- G’Mic için çeşitli düzeltmeler (MR 1464).
- Kayıt işlemi başarısız olursa artık uyarıyoruz (MR 1410).
- Düzeyler süzgeci artık kanal başına uygulanabiliyor (MR 1067).
Yaptıklarımızı beğeniyor musunuz? Bize destek olun
Krita özgür ve açık kaynaklı bir projedir. Lütfen projeyi bağışlarla veya eğitim videoları veya sanat kitapları satın alarak desteklemeyi düşünün! Desteğinizle, çekirdek takımın Krita üzerinde tam zamanlı olarak çalışmasını sağlayabilirsiniz.
Bağış Yap Bir şeyler satın al